Molybdenum Disulfide (MoS₂) Grease Explained

Molybdenum disulfide grease — “moly grease” — is a normal grease carrying a solid lubricant: fine particles of molybdenum disulfide (MoS₂). Under heavy load, shock or slow-speed sliding, the oil film thins and metal nearly touches metal; the MoS₂ plates out on the surface and keeps the two faces apart. That gives outstanding extreme-pressure and anti-wear protection where a plain grease would let the film collapse. Here is how it works, typical specs, and where it belongs.

How it works

A solid lubricant that plates onto metal

Molybdenum disulfide has a layered, plate-like crystal structure whose sheets slide over one another with very little resistance — like graphite. Blended into grease as a fine powder, those plates deposit on the metal surfaces and form a slippery, load-bearing solid film.

That film matters most in boundary lubrication: when load is high, motion is slow, or a joint reverses under shock, the hydrodynamic oil film thins to almost nothing and asperities touch. The MoS₂ layer carries the load and stops metal-to-metal welding and scuffing — complementing the liquid EP additives already in the grease.

MoS₂ (and graphite) are used exactly where oil films fail: shock-loaded, oscillating or very slow contacts. At high speed, a well-formulated oil film already does the job and the solid adds little.

Why choose it

Key benefits

  • High load-carrying capacity — the MoS₂ film endures extreme pressures that break a plain oil film.
  • Superior wear protection — reduces friction and scuffing, extending component life.
  • Thermal stability — synthetic-based moly greases work over a wide temperature range with a high dropping point.
  • Water & corrosion resistance — protects against moisture and oxidation in harsh service.
  • Boundary performance — stays effective under shock load and in slow-moving, oscillating contacts.
Specs

Typical MoS₂ grease specification

PropertyTypical value
ThickenerLithium complex / polyurea / Ca sulfonate
Base oilSynthetic (PAO or ester), or mineral
MoS₂ content3% – 5%
NLGI grade1, 2 or 3
Temperature range−40 to +250 °C (synthetic)
Dropping point> 280 °C
4-ball weld load (ASTM D2596)400 – 800 kg

Indicative values — MoS₂ percentage, thickener and base oil are tuned to the load, temperature and speed of the application.

Where it fits

Applications

Heavy machinery & mining

Bearings, bushings and pins under extreme, shock loads — see open-gear and mining greases.

Automotive

CV joints, wheel bearings and suspension components; moly is classic CV-joint grease.

Industrial gears & bearings

High-temperature, high-pressure equipment where boundary contact is common.

Construction & earthmoving

Loaders, cranes, pins and bushes exposed to load, dirt and water.

MoS₂ grease is not the right choice for high-speed precision or electric-motor bearings, where the solid particles offer no benefit and finer greases are preferred.

Molybdenum disulfide grease FAQ

What is molybdenum disulfide (MoS₂) grease?

It is a grease that carries molybdenum disulfide — a solid lubricant — dispersed as a fine powder, typically at 3–5%. MoS₂ has a layered structure that shears easily and plates onto metal surfaces, giving extra extreme-pressure and anti-wear protection under heavy load, shock and slow-speed sliding where an oil film alone is insufficient.

What does the MoS₂ actually do in the grease?

Under boundary conditions — high load, low speed or shock — the oil film thins until metal surfaces nearly touch. The MoS₂ particles deposit on those surfaces as a slippery solid film that carries the load and prevents metal-to-metal welding and scuffing, complementing the grease’s liquid EP additives.

How much MoS₂ is used in moly grease?

Typically 3% to 5% by weight. Too little gives limited solid-film benefit; too much can affect pumpability and film formation. The exact level is tuned to the load and application, alongside the thickener, base oil and EP additive system.

Where should molybdenum disulfide grease be used?

It is ideal for heavily loaded, shock-loaded or slow, oscillating contacts: CV joints, pins and bushings, mining and construction equipment, open gears and slow heavy bearings. It is not recommended for high-speed precision bearings or electric-motor bearings, where finer greases perform better.

Is moly grease the same as graphite grease?

Both use a layered solid lubricant for boundary protection, and they are sometimes combined. MoS₂ generally gives higher load-carrying performance and works well in the absence of moisture, while graphite is often chosen for very high temperatures. The best choice depends on the load, temperature and environment.
